NYS DFS Issues New Cybersecurity Guidance on Risk Assessments for Financial Services Entities
New York DFS issued cybersecurity guidance defining expectations for risk assessments that regulated financial services entities must conduct.
On September 10, 2026, NYS DFS Acting Superintendent Kaitlin Asrow issued new cybersecurity guidance on conducting risk assessments sufficient to inform cybersecurity programs. The guidance covers scope, frequency, and the role of assessments for DFS-regulated financial services entities. It does not describe any incident or vulnerability, but sets regulatory compliance expectations under DFS cybersecurity rules.
The Republican Nominee for New York Governor Made a Creepy, AI-Generated Video of Mamdani and Hochul
NY gubernatorial nominee Bruce Blakeman posted an unlabeled AI-generated video of Mamdani and Hochul, prompting a Board of Elections complaint.
Bruce Blakeman, the Republican nominee for New York governor, posted an AI-generated video depicting New York City Mayor Zohran Mamdani and Governor Kathy Hochul gardening and cycling together. The New York State Democratic Party filed a complaint with the Board of Elections alleging the video violates state election law requiring disclosure of materially deceptive AI-generated political media. Blakeman argues the video is protected satire or parody under the law's exceptions.
